My Buying Guides on 48 Volt Electric Bicycle Battery
Why I Care About the Right 48 Volt Battery
When I look for a 48 volt electric bicycle battery, I focus on more than just voltage. I want a battery that gives me reliable range, strong performance, and safe daily use. In my experience, the right battery can completely change how enjoyable an e-bike feels, especially on hills, longer rides, or during commuting.
Check Battery Compatibility First
The first thing I always verify is whether the battery matches my bike’s motor and controller. A 48 volt battery must be compatible with the e-bike system, including the connector type, mounting style, and controller limits. If I ignore compatibility, I risk poor performance or even damage to the bike.
Look at Battery Capacity
I pay close attention to amp-hours (Ah) because that tells me how much energy the battery can store. A higher Ah rating usually means longer riding distance. If I want more range, I choose a battery with a larger capacity, but I also make sure it still fits my bike and budget.
Understand Range Expectations
I never rely only on the advertised range. Real-world distance depends on my riding style, terrain, rider weight, wind, tire pressure, and assist level. When I compare batteries, I think about how far I actually ride in a typical day instead of trusting the best-case estimate.
Pay Attention to Battery Type
I usually look for lithium-ion batteries because they are lighter, last longer, and charge more efficiently than older battery types. For me, lithium-ion is the practical choice for most 48 volt electric bicycles. I also check whether the battery uses quality cells, since cell quality affects lifespan and performance.
Check the Battery Management System
I always want a battery with a good Battery Management System, or BMS. This helps protect against overcharging, over-discharging, overheating, and short circuits. In my experience, a solid BMS is one of the most important safety features I can get.
Consider Weight and Size
I make sure the battery is not too heavy or bulky for my bike setup. A battery that is too large can be awkward to mount and may affect handling. I prefer a size and weight that feels balanced and practical for everyday riding.
Think About Charging Time
I check how long the battery takes to charge because that affects how convenient it is to use. If I ride often, I want a battery that charges in a reasonable amount of time. I also make sure the charger is included or available separately, and that it matches the battery specifications.
Look for Safety Certifications
I feel more confident when a battery has proper safety certifications and comes from a trusted brand. Certifications can give me peace of mind that the battery has been tested for safety and quality. I avoid batteries that seem suspiciously cheap or lack clear product information.
Compare Warranty and Customer Support
I always check the warranty before I buy. A good warranty tells me the seller stands behind the product. I also like responsive customer support, because if I have an issue with fit, charging, or performance, I want help quickly.
Choose a Trusted Seller
In my experience, buying from a reputable seller matters just as much as the battery itself. I look for clear product descriptions, honest reviews, and return policies. A trustworthy seller makes the buying process much easier and reduces the chance of disappointment.
My Final Advice
When I buy a 48 volt electric bicycle battery, I focus on compatibility, capacity, safety, and build quality. I do not rush the decision, because the battery is one of the most important parts of the e-bike. If I choose carefully, I get better rides, better range, and better long-term value.
